Speedway - About the company

Speedway is an acquired company based in Enon (United States), founded in 1959 by Alvi Sameer. It operates as a Provider of fuel, convenience store items, and financial services. Company Details

Provider of fuel, convenience store items, and financial services. This company operates a network of retail locations offering gasoline, a variety of food and beverage options, and car washes. They also provide financial services including Speedy Rewards loyalty programs, various prepaid cards, and reloadable debit cards. The company's offerings cater to the daily needs of consumers seeking fuel and convenience.

Speedway's acquisition details

Speedway got acquired by 7-Eleven on Aug 02, 2020 at an acquisition amount of $21B. It was facilitated by Barclays, Wachtell, Lipton, Rosen & Katz and J P Morgan.
